Building Resources, Growing Readers
Funded Mar 4, 2022Thank you so much for contributing to our cause. This year's class was able to use the last edition of Storyworks and loved it! That makes me even more excited for next school year when we will get a full year of editions.
Storyworks provided the students with a variety of fiction and non-fiction texts that included poems, plays, articles, and short stories. The students loved the variety of engaging texts. The activities that accompany the texts were engaging and meaningful. They were also directly aligned with many content standards. The online resources include videos and related activities that engage and challenge students.
